The 10 best houseplants for regulating temperature and humidity in your home.

 

Did you know that some houseplants can influence the humidity and overall comfort of your indoor environment?

Plants release water vapor through a natural process called transpiration. While a few plants can contribute to indoor humidity, they won't replace a humidifier, air conditioner, or proper ventilation.

Still, choosing the right plants can make your home feel fresher, greener, and more comfortable.

Here are 10 houseplants worth considering.

1. Areca Palm

The areca palm is a popular indoor plant with long, feathery leaves.

Because it releases moisture through its leaves, it can contribute to humidity in a room, particularly when several plants are grouped together.

It also grows well in bright, indirect light and can make a beautiful addition to living rooms and bedrooms.

2. Boston Fern

Boston ferns are especially associated with humid environments.

Their dense foliage releases moisture through transpiration, which can contribute to a more humid atmosphere around the plant.

Keep the soil consistently moist without leaving the plant sitting in stagnant water, and provide indirect light.

3. Peace Lily

Peace lilies are attractive, relatively compact houseplants with broad green leaves and distinctive flowers.

Their foliage contributes to natural moisture release through transpiration.

They generally prefer warm indoor conditions, indirect light, and evenly moist soil.

4. Spider Plant

Spider plants are easy to grow and adaptable to many indoor conditions.

Their long, narrow leaves release moisture as part of normal plant activity, while their compact size makes them suitable for bedrooms, offices, and smaller living spaces.

Allow the soil to dry slightly between waterings rather than keeping it constantly soaked.

5. Rubber Plant

Rubber plants have large, thick leaves that make them an attractive choice for bright indoor spaces.

Like other leafy plants, they release water vapor through their leaves.

They prefer bright, indirect light and generally do best when the soil is allowed to dry somewhat between waterings.

6. English Ivy

English ivy can grow indoors when given suitable light and support.

Its trailing foliage adds greenery to shelves and hanging containers, while normal transpiration contributes a small amount of moisture to the surrounding air.

Keep it in a location with bright, indirect light and good airflow.

7. Bamboo Palm

Bamboo palms are another tropical-looking option for indoor spaces.

Their large amount of foliage allows them to release moisture through transpiration.

They generally prefer bright, filtered light and consistently but moderately moist soil.

8. Dracaena

Dracaenas are popular because they are relatively easy to maintain and come in many varieties.

Their leaves participate in normal transpiration, meaning they release some water vapor into the surrounding environment.

They can tolerate indoor conditions well, although their exact light and watering requirements depend on the variety.

9. Calathea

Calatheas are known for their striking patterned leaves.

Many varieties naturally grow in tropical environments, so they tend to appreciate higher humidity indoors.

If your home is particularly dry, placing a calathea near other plants can help create a more humid microenvironment around the foliage.

10. Monstera

Monsteras are large tropical plants with distinctive split leaves.

Like other leafy houseplants, they release moisture through transpiration.

Monsteras generally prefer bright, indirect light and moderate watering. Their large foliage can also make them an impressive focal point in a living room or home office.

Can Houseplants Really Regulate the Temperature in Your Home?

This is where expectations matter.

Houseplants do not function like air conditioners or heaters.

A few plants are unlikely to noticeably lower the temperature of an entire room. Their main environmental effect is related to moisture and the immediate area around the foliage.

Plants can lose water through transpiration, and this process can have a cooling effect on the air immediately surrounding the plant.

However, the effect in an ordinary home is usually modest.

For meaningful temperature control, insulation, shading, ventilation, fans, heating, and air conditioning are much more effective.

How Houseplants Can Affect Indoor Humidity

Plants release water vapor through their leaves during transpiration.

When multiple healthy plants are grouped together, especially in a well-watered indoor environment, they can contribute some additional moisture to the surrounding air.

The effect depends on factors such as:

  • Number of plants
  • Plant size
  • Leaf area
  • Temperature
  • Light levels
  • Water availability
  • Ventilation
  • Room size

A small plant in a large, well-ventilated room won't dramatically change the humidity.

How to Get the Most From Your Plants

If you want your houseplants to contribute to a comfortable indoor environment, placement matters.

Group plants together

Placing several plants relatively close together can create a more humid microenvironment around them.

Choose the right room

A bright living room, home office, or other suitable space can work well depending on the plant's light requirements.

Avoid overwatering

More water doesn't automatically mean more humidity in a healthy way.

Overwatering can damage roots and create conditions that encourage mold and other problems.

Improve natural airflow

Good ventilation is important for both people and plants. Don't pack plants into a poorly ventilated corner.

Monitor humidity

If you're concerned about indoor humidity, a simple hygrometer can give you a much better idea of your home's actual humidity than relying on how the air feels.

What About Dry Winter Air?

During colder months, indoor heating can make the air feel noticeably dry.

Houseplants may contribute a small amount of moisture, but they shouldn't be your only solution if indoor humidity is very low.

A properly maintained humidifier can provide much more direct control when additional humidity is needed.

What About High Humidity?

More humidity isn't always better.

Excessively humid indoor conditions can encourage mold and create an uncomfortable environment.

If your home already has high humidity, adding many moisture-loving plants may not be the best strategy.

Ventilation and appropriate humidity control are more important.
